Lord Mayors Car parked illegally
Graham made this Freedom of Information request to Westminster City Council
The request was refused by Westminster City Council.
From: Graham
25 September 2009
Dear Sir or Madam,
I notice their is publicly available proof that the mayors car was
parked illegally (on a double yellow line, facing the WRONG WAY up
a one way street) online at http://nutsville.com/?p=42
Please can you advise what action was taken against the mayor
and/or the mayors driver over this parking infringement - as I am
sure if it had been me parked like that I would have received a
parking fine by now!
Please also advise what communications were sent to your employees
following this incident to ensure it is not repeated
Yours faithfully,
Graham
